Morphological variants of silent bared-teeth displays have different social interaction outcomes in crested macaques (Macaca nigra).

What was done

Researchers recorded spontaneous behavior in wild crested macaques (Macaca nigra) and objectively coded silent bared-teeth (SBT) facial displays using the anatomically based Macaque Facial Action Coding System. Discriminant analysis and bootstrapping were used to determine whether morphological features of SBT displays differed across four interaction contexts defined by outcome: Affiliation, Copulation, Play, and Submission.

What was found

SBT expressions produced across the four behavioral contexts were distinguishable at rates significantly above chance, indicating context-specific morphological differences. Specific facial movements, along with their variability and intensity, varied systematically between contexts. The abstract reports no specific numerical figures, percentages, or effect sizes.

Why it matters

This study demonstrates that nonhuman primate facial expressions contain subtle, context-dependent morphological variations analogous to human facial communication, suggesting that rigid categorical repertoires oversimplify primate communication complexity.

Limits

The abstract does not report the number of individuals, troops, or discrete facial displays analyzed. Findings are restricted to a single species of macaque, and exact classification accuracies, statistical test values, and inter-rater reliability metrics are omitted from the abstract.
